$3.43

Save:$6.55 (66%)

Quantity

1 in stock

More Information

Format: Illustrated
Pages: 168
Edition: Illustrated
Publisher: Seren
Published: 25 Nov 1998

ISBN 10: 1854110330
ISBN 13: 9781854110336